QUARTERLY PLANNING NOTE — Branch Managers

Quick word on the gross-margin review. Q3 margins slipped to 31% across most branches, mainly from freight costs and heavy discounting on the Pinefold range. For Q4 we're tightening discount authority — anything over 10% needs regional sign-off. Branch-level margin targets land next week; expect them to be a stretch but doable. Flag any local cost pressures early rather than at review. The confidential note on our plans sits below:

board note of bawep-tajef: Queniusek Systems plans to raise the Quenvan list price by 53.1 percent in March. The pricing group signed off on a budget of $176.4 million for Project Drueth. The renewal with Casionix Partners closes at $142.5 million a year, 8.3 percent below the last contract. Project Fraax slips by six weeks because of the tooling delay.

The garage occupancy feed for the Brindlewood campus arrives over a message queue every thirty seconds, one record per level, published by the Stallgrid edge boxes. Counts can briefly go negative when a sensor double-fires on exit; the ingest job clamps these to zero and flags the interval. If the feed stalls for more than five minutes, the dashboard falls back to the last known snapshot. Sensor mappings, queue names, and the replay procedure are documented on the internal page below.

runbook for tahog-kadug: https://gitlab.qirvanworks.corp/projects/pages/view/b139298aed28

Welcome to the Lanternleaf consent banner program. Plugin authors must register each banner variant before rollout so the Driftgate compliance checker can validate copy, locale coverage, and dismissal behavior. Please test against the staging consent ledger rather than production; consent records are immutable once written, and malformed entries cannot be purged without a formal review. To connect your local plugin harness to the staging ledger, configure your client with the connection string below.

replica DSN, hadug-yajep: postgresql://aldiel_svc:W4u8z42Jo5IFtG@db-1656.torvacorp.local:5432/holael